As of August 01, 2026, the average salary for a Data Modeling Analyst in the United States is $105,456 per year, which breaks down to an hourly rate of $51.
However, a Data Modeling Analyst's salary can vary significantly. Here’s a look at the typical salary range:
Data Modeling Analyst Salaries by Percentile
| Annual Salary |
Monthly Pay |
Weekly Pay |
Hourly Wage |
|
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 75th Percentile | $112,409 | $9,367 | $2,162 | $54 |
| Average | $105,456 | $8,788 | $2,028 | $51 |
| 25th Percentile | $96,367 | $8,031 | $1,853 | $46 |

Experience is a primary driver of a Data Modeling Analyst's salary. As you build your skills and take on more complex tasks, your compensation generally increases. Here's how the average salary grows at different career stages:
| Levels | Salary |
|---|---|
| Entry Level Data Modeling Analyst | $102,472 |
| Intermediate Level Data Modeling Analyst | $102,743 |
| Senior Level Data Modeling Analyst | $105,975 |
| Specialist Level Data Modeling Analyst | $108,881 |
| Expert Level Data Modeling Analyst | $109,088 |

Data Modeling Analyst salary potential scales significantly with company size. Data shows that Enterprise companies (5,000+ employees) pay the highest average salary at around $118,052. While startup companies pay approximate $99,869.
| Company Size | Employees | Average Salary |
|---|---|---|
| Startup | 1~50 | $99,869 |
| Growth Stage | 51~500 | $105,623 |
| Established | 501~5000 | $114,000 |
| Enterprise | 5000+ | $118,052 |

Develops data models to meet the needs of the organization's information systems. Manages the flow of information between departments through the use of relational databases. Maintains data integrity by working to eliminate redundancy. Stays informed of the ways the organization uses its data. Requires a bachelor's degree. Typically reports to a manager. Gains exposure to some of the complex tasks within the job function. Occasionally directed in several aspects of the work. Typically requires 2 to 4 years of related experience.
